KS2 1:1 SEN Teaching Assistant – Year 6 (SEMH & Attachment Needs) Location: Liverpool (L5) Start Date: September Contract Type: Long-term Milk Education are working in partnership with a warm, inclusive, and high-performing mainstream Primary School in the Liverpool (L5) area to recruit a 1:1 SEN Teaching Assistant to support a Year 6 pupil on a long-term basis (whole academic year). The role is set to begin in September, with the possibility of a trial day in July or early September. This is a school that prides itself on being a happy, caring, and nurturing environment, with high expectations for behaviour and achievement. About the Role: You will be working on a one-to-one basis with a Year 6 pupil who presents with SEMH (Social, Emotional and Mental Health) needs and attachment difficulties. The pupil is currently working at a Lower KS2 academic level, so this role requires someone with empathy, adaptability, and a consistent approach. Key Responsibilities: Provide dedicated 1:1 support tailored to the pupil’s emotional, behavioural, and academic needs Build and maintain a trusting relationship with the pupil using a trauma-informed approach Implement strategies to support emotional regulation and positive behaviour Assist the pupil in accessing learning across the curriculum, working at a Lower KS2 level Collaborate with the class teacher and SENCO to adapt lessons and deliver targeted interventions Support the pupil in preparing for the transition to secondary school Requirements: Recent experience supporting pupils with SEMH and attachment needs Experience working within KS2, ideally in a Year 6 setting A calm, patient, and resilient approach to behaviour management Good literacy and numeracy skills Ability to follow teacher guidance while using initiative to respond to pupil needs Why Work with Milk Education?
